Job Description
Established in 1991, Systech continues to evolve, providing responsive, high quality multi-disciplinary services to support the delivery of major construction, infrastructure, and energy projects.
Our team of over 500 professionals deliver services over the full lifespan of projects โ from bid to handover, from our offices in Europe, the Middle East, Africa, Asia Pacific, and the Americas.
We continuously strive to improve how we deliver services to our clients and feel incredibly proud of the long-standing relationships we have built with clients and contractors across the globe.
Role
Systech is seeking to hire a highly qualified and technically proficient Director with a proven track record of developing client relationships, managing teams and working as a contracts / claims manager in construction projects. This is a diverse role that requires leadership, interpersonal, technical, and business development skills.
You will work closely with our Regional Managing Director, Canada, assisting him in continuing to grow our business in the region. You will divide your time between managing strategic client relationships, leading on fee earning assignments, overseeing staff, recruitment, and business development.
You will need to work hard and achieve strong performance levels. In return you will have a clearly defined route to a senior management position within a leading consultancy. It suits someone who enjoys working closely with key clients, priding themselves on delivering an exceptional service.
The ideal candidate will have prior experience of preparing claims and leading commercial teams on major infrastructure projects. This is a consultancy environment, and you must therefore be able to demonstrate an ability to effectively interact with both internal and external stakeholders.
Responsibilities
To prepare a business plan and strive towards achieving its objectives
To develop relationships with Systechโs existing client base
To establish relationships with new target clients
To positively contribute to a business development focussed culture
To work collaboratively with the management team across Systechโs international offices
To manage and build teams, fostering strong relationships with your reports
To lead assignments and provide a reliable and high-quality service
To advise of dispute avoidance and resolution strategy
To advise clients on their claims strategy and prepare claims
To assist more junior members of staff with their career development
To be positive and proactive, overcoming obstacles and finding a way to win
Individual
BSc (Hons) in Quantity Surveying
A Member of The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ors (preferred)
Local knowledge / experience of the Canadian market (preferred).
Strong oral and written communication and presentation skills
Presentable and articulate
Analytical and methodical
Collaborative and able to work towards a common goal
Dynamic and passionate career focused individual
Embrace innovation and new ideas
